/// PNG file header
struct PNG_Header {
	char dummy[12];
	char signature[4]; //< must be "IHDR"
	unsigned char high_width[2]; //< image width high bytes [we ignore for now]
	unsigned char width[2]; //< image width low bytes
	unsigned char high_height[2]; //< image height high bytes [we ignore for now]
	unsigned char height[4]; //< image height
};

/// GIF file header
struct GIF_Header {
	char       signature[3];         // 'GIF'
	char       version[3];
	unsigned char       width[2];
	unsigned char       height[2];
	char       dif;
	char       fonColor;
	char       nulls;
};

/// JPEG record head
struct JPG_Segment_head {
	unsigned char marker;
	unsigned char code;
	unsigned char length[2];
};
/// JPEG frame header
struct JPG_Size_segment_body {
	char data;                    //< data precision of bits/sample
	unsigned char height[2];               //< image height
	unsigned char width[2];                //< image width
	char numComponents;           //< number of color components
};

//

inline ushort x_endian_to_ushort(unsigned char L, unsigned char H) {
	return(short)((H<<8) + L);
}

inline ushort big_endian_to_ushort(unsigned char b[2]) {
	return x_endian_to_ushort(b[1], b[0]);
}

inline ushort little_endian_to_ushort(unsigned char b[2]) {
	return x_endian_to_ushort(b[0], b[1]);
}

void measure_gif(Pool& pool, const String *origin_string, 
			 Measure_reader& reader, ushort& width, ushort& height) {

	void *buf;
	const int head_size=sizeof(GIF_Header);
	if(reader.read(buf, head_size)<head_size)
		throw Exception("image.format", 
			origin_string, 
			"not GIF file - too small");
	GIF_Header *head=(GIF_Header *)buf;

	if(strncmp(head->signature, "GIF", 3)!=0)
		throw Exception("image.format", 
			origin_string, 
			"not GIF file - wrong signature");	

	width=little_endian_to_ushort(head->width);
	height=little_endian_to_ushort(head->height);
}

/// @test remove ugly mech in reader - 20K limit
void measure_jpeg(Pool& pool, const String *origin_string, 
			 Measure_reader& reader, ushort& width, ushort& height) {
	// JFIF format markers
	const unsigned char MARKER=0xFF;
	const unsigned char CODE_SIZE_FIRST=0xC0;
	const unsigned char CODE_SIZE_LAST=0xC3;

	void *buf;
	const size_t prefix_size=2;
	if(reader.read(buf, prefix_size)<prefix_size)
		throw Exception("image.format", 
			origin_string, 
			"not JPEG file - too small");
	unsigned char *signature=(unsigned char *)buf;
	
	if(!(signature[0]==0xFF && signature[1]==0xD8)) 
		throw Exception("image.format", 
			origin_string, 
			"not JPEG file - wrong signature");

	bool found=false;
	while(true) {
		void *buf;
        // Extract the segment header.
		if(reader.read(buf, sizeof(JPG_Segment_head))<sizeof(JPG_Segment_head))
			break;		
		JPG_Segment_head *head=(JPG_Segment_head *)buf;

        // Verify that it's a valid segment.
		if(head->marker!=MARKER)
			break;

		if(head->code >= CODE_SIZE_FIRST && head->code  <= CODE_SIZE_LAST) {
            // Segments that contain size info
			if(reader.read(buf, sizeof(JPG_Size_segment_body))<sizeof(JPG_Size_segment_body))
				break;
			JPG_Size_segment_body *body=(JPG_Size_segment_body *)buf;
			
			width=big_endian_to_ushort(body->width);
			height=big_endian_to_ushort(body->height);
			found=true;
			break;
		} else {
            // Dummy read to skip over data
            long offset=big_endian_to_ushort(head->length) - 2;
			reader.seek(offset);
        }
	}

	if(!found)
		throw Exception("image.format", 
			origin_string, 
			"broken JPEG file - size frame not found");
}

void measure_png(Pool& pool, const String *origin_string, 
			 Measure_reader& reader, ushort& width, ushort& height) {

	void *buf;
	const int head_size=sizeof(PNG_Header);
	if(reader.read(buf, head_size)<head_size)
		throw Exception("image.format", 
			origin_string, 
			"not PNG file - too small");
	PNG_Header *head=(PNG_Header *)buf;

	if(strncmp(head->signature, "IHDR", 4)!=0)
		throw Exception("image.format", 
			origin_string, 
			"not PNG file - wrong signature");	

	width=big_endian_to_ushort(head->width);
	height=big_endian_to_ushort(head->height);
}
